  • Which airport in Greece is closest to Meteora?

    Most travelers visiting Meteora opt to fly into SKG. About 90 miles away, it is one of the closest airports to the attraction. Your flight to SKG will include either one or two layovers in Frankfurt (FRA), Zurich (ZRH), Atlanta (ATL), New York (JFK), or Khimki (SVO) and last about 17-22 hours, depending on the airline. You can then use public transport, like the bus, to get from SKG to Meteora. You can also drive to Meteora with a rental car from the airport, which is faster than taking the bus.

  • Which cities are served by Greece’s main airports?

    Athens Airport is the primary airport receiving a majority of the international flights to Greece. The airport is about 16 miles from the city center of Athens. It mainly serves the region of Attica and cities like Athens. As the second main international airport, SKG is about eight miles from Thessaloniki’s city center. This airport serves most of northern Greece, such as cities in Central Macedonia and Thessaloniki.

  • Can I get a rental car at airports in Greece?

    Yes, several car rental companies have offices at airports in Greece. The arrivals hall of the Main Terminal at Athens Airport serves as the host of car rental companies like Avance, Hertz, Budget, and Enterprise. You can also find rental cars from Europcar, Hertz, and Sixt at Thessaloniki Airport.

Top tips for finding cheap flights to Greece

  • Morning departure is around 13% more expensive than an evening flight, on average*.
  • Miami International Airport (MIA) is the main provider for flights to Greece from Miami. You will find airlines with flights to Greece at Concourses E and F of the Central Terminal. Flights from Miami to Greece include at least a single layover en route.
  • You can kick back and relax after your 16-hour flight once you arrive at Athens International Airport (ATH). The airport has over a dozen lounges located at the Main Terminal and the Satellite Terminal.
  • Enjoy a meal at MIA before your long flight to Greece if you don’t like eating during flights. MIA now has contactless dining, and you can order your meals from selected restaurants at the airport via the MIA app and enjoy convenient pick-up.
  • Onsite currency exchange services are available at ATH. Head to the Arrivals or Departures levels for your foreign exchange needs. These services are open 24/7.
  • US citizens can enter Greece without a visa for business or tourism travel lasting less than 90 days. Greek law also requires a passport with three months remaining validity from your planned departure date.
